How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Manhattan?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Manhattan Studio Apartments | $4,026 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,581 | $995 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,958 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,986 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,986 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,021 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
Manhattan 6 Bedroom Apartments | $3,338 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Furnished Manhattan Apartments
What is the Cheapest Furnished apartment in Manhattan?
Currently the most affordable Furnished Apartment in Manhattan is at 14 St Marks Pl listed at $1,100.
How much is the average rent for a Furnished Manhattan Apartment?
The average rent for a Furnished Apartment in Manhattan is $4,648.
What is the largest Furnished Manhattan Apartment for rent?
Today's Furnished apartment with the most square footage in Manhattan is a 3,500 square feet unit starting from $4,774 at 21 Chelsea.
What is the average size for Manhattan Furnished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Furnished rental in Manhattan is currently at 596 sq ft.
